Transaction 30106e0435fca154928f1e1e79fd8cefa25db411beb058f5ce86f486f51f3121
1 Input
2 Outputs
- 30106e0435fca154928f1e1e79fd8cefa25db411beb058f5ce86f486f51f3121:0
- 30106e0435fca154928f1e1e79fd8cefa25db411beb058f5ce86f486f51f3121:1
value 80279
address 12CCLFMadBZ962F3maYmmFCeEgHC8YWKLq
value 1446913
address 1PQfyYHDiyxt6KqyCU2ty9uLFGwicAgXYD